Bajkit vs Mandalay Climate & Distance Between

Myanmar flag
  • The distance between Bajkit, Russia and Mandalay, Myanmar is approximately 4,413 km or 2,742 mi.
  • To reach Bajkit in this distance one would set out from Mandalay bearing 0.2°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Bajkit bearing 0.4° or N .
  • Bajkit has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Mandalay has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
  • Bajkit is in or near the boreal moist forest biome whereas Mandalay is in or near the tropical very dry for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 33.8 °C (60.8°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 37.5 °C (67.5°F) more in Bajkit. The continentality subtype is hypercont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 397 mm (15.6 in) less which is equivalent to 397 l/m² (9.74 US gal/ft²) or 3,970,000 l/ha (424,419 US gal/ac) less. About 4/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 39.3° lower in Bajkit than in Mandalay.
